The Good
- Basic Strategy: Utilizing a basic strategy chart can reduce the house edge to as low as 0.5%. This strategy outlines the optimal play based on your hand and the dealer’s visible card.
- Card Counting: While challenging, effective card counting can give players an edge. Players can adjust their bets based on the ratio of high cards to low cards remaining in the deck.
- Bankroll Management: Setting a budget and adhering to it can prevent significant losses. A common recommendation is to play with no more than 1%-2% of your total bankroll per hand.
The Bad
- Over-Reliance on Strategies: Many players become overly dependent on strategies like card counting, which can lead to mistakes. For instance, if you’re distracted or nervous, you might miscalculate your bets.
- Complexity of Advanced Techniques: Strategies like shuffle tracking can be complicated and require extensive practice. Not all players can successfully implement these without extensive experience.
- Misunderstanding Rules: Failing to grasp the specific rules of the game you’re playing can lead to poor decisions. For example, some casinos have different rules regarding splitting and doubling down.
